WebSo we can write the formula for the circumference of a circle as: \ (C = \pi d\) However, the diameter is equal to \ (2 \times radius\), (\ (2r\)), so we can also write this formula as: \ [C = 2 \pi r\] It does not matter which of these formulae you use. But you must be careful to use the correct length for the formula (the radius or diameter).
